Methyl 1-benzyl-4-hydroxypiperidine-4-carboxylate is a versatile compound used in chemical synthesis for its unique properties and reactivity. This compound serves as a key building block in the synthesis of various pharmaceuticals, agrochemicals, and fine chemicals due to its structural features.In chemical synthesis, Methyl 1-benzyl-4-hydroxypiperidine-4-carboxylate can act as a precursor for the preparation of complex molecules through a series of functional group transformations. Its piperidine ring provides a scaffold for further derivatization, allowing for the introduction of different substituents or modifications to tailor the compound's properties.Furthermore, the presence of the benzyl and methyl ester groups in Methyl 1-benzyl-4-hydroxypiperidine-4-carboxylate offers opportunities for selective reactions that can lead to the formation of diverse chemical structures. These functional groups can participate in various organic transformations such as acylation, alkylation, or reduction reactions, expanding the synthetic possibilities of this compound.Overall, Methyl 1-benzyl-4-hydroxypiperidine-4-carboxylate plays a crucial role in the synthesis of structurally diverse compounds with potential applications in the fields of medicine, agriculture, and materials science. Its versatility and reactivity make it a valuable component in the toolbox of synthetic chemists seeking to create novel molecules with specific properties and functions.
